Reputation The electrical infrastructure of the uk electrician is dependent on the work of electricians. Their expertise is essential to ensure that hospitals, care homes, schools and other structures protected from electricity and fire dangers. Having the right credentials and a good reputation are important when choosing an electrician. There are a variety of sources that can assist you in finding the best candidate for the job. The National Inspection Council for Electrical Installation Contracting is one of the most reliable sources. This organization checks an electrician's qualifications, safety credentials and insurance before they're certified. It also allows you to see a list of registered electricians in your region and gives you an easy method of contacting them. TrustATrader is another reliable source of information. Insurance Electricians are employed in many areas such as rewiring homes or repair of electrical equipment. No matter if you're a sole-trader, or part of a larger organization, electricians need to ensure they have appropriate insurance to safeguard themselves from dangers that could harm their business or livelihood. Insurance policies for electricians can range from simple public liability coverage, to more comprehensive protection , such as employers' liability and even income protection. These policies are designed to safeguard your business in the event that something catastrophic occurred and you are unable to continue working. It is contingent on the job you work at, it's important to make sure that your tools and vehicles are protected in the case of an accident, theft, or fire. A product liability policy may be a good option to safeguard you against claims from customers who claim injury, damage or death caused by products you have provided or imported. It is also crucial to ensure you have enough insurance coverage for every employee you hire. This covers employees who are working on your premises or contractors working on site, as well as casual employees that you employ to fill in unexpected time off.
